As you know, at this age, it is best to minimize sun exposure, especially from 11am to 4pm, by putting the child in the shade and having him or her wear long clothes that show a good UV protection score.
But when this is not possible, mineral filter type sunscreen can be applied to the skin exposed to the sun. These creams come in several brands, so LaRoche Posay, and usually leave a white film on the skin that reflects sunlight.
You should use a cream that has an SPF of at least 30, and reapply the cream every 2 hours.
